Join us for the 3rd Annual Thunder at the Lake Poker Run being hosted by Kelly’s Port at Lake of the Ozarks on July 23rd, 24th, 25th 2009

This Annual event has grown bigger every year and is filled with 3 days of some of the nicest performance boats from across the country.

Thursday Night July 23rd, 2009

Thunder at the Lake will be kicking off once again with a Pre-Registration party at the Horny Toad from 5pm to 10pm Thursday night where everyone can enjoy great food and drinks while checking out some of the power sitting on the docks. (Last chance to get in on your early registration)

Friday July 24th, 2009

Final registration from 8:00 am to 10:45 am at Kelly’s Port located by water on the 22 MM.

There will be a mandatory Captains meeting at 11:00 am where we will cover final details or last minute changes to the day.

Join us for a continental breakfast consisting of Bagels, donuts, Coffee and orange juice.

Kelly’s port will have staff on hand to cover and assist with any last minute needs such as Fuel, water, Ice and service if needed.

Our First Group heads out at 11:20 lead by a designated pace boat as our Helicopters set course to get some of the best video and camera footage available.

1st Stop: The New Captain’s Galley
2nd Stop: Big Dicks Halfway Inn
3rd Stop: Coconuts Caribbean Beach Bar and Grill
4th stop: Horny Toad
5th Stop: Dog Day’s

Friday Night

Join everyone back at Kelly’s Port for Final Card Turn in along with Dinner and the JJBAGS Band!

There will be giveaways and raffles as in the past.

Each participant will recieve a raffle ticket allowing them a chance to win one of the different prizes.

Raffle tickets will be given at check in or during registration at the event. We will be giving away prizes on Friday night after the poker run during awards and Saturday night at the VIP party at Jerimiah's night club

1st Place

40%

2nd Place

30 %

3rd Place

10%

Charity

20%

(Kelly's Port has Named The Dream Factory to recieve any charitable contributions)

These are all paid based on number of poker hands purchased


You do not have to hit each stop in order to recieve any missed cards at the end during card turn in.

If you would like to run the whole lake or go part way and change directions you may do so.

For those participants who make all stops you will be put into a drawing that will pay a $300 Gas Card good at Kelly's Port Marina anytime!
